> sched: accumulate per-cfs_rq cpu usage > > From: Paul Turner <pjt@google.com> > > Introduce account_cfs_rq_quota() to account bandwidth usage on the cfs_rq > level versus task_groups for which bandwidth has been assigned. This is > tracked by whether the local cfs_rq->quota_assigned is finite or infinite > (RUNTIME_INF). > > For cfs_rq's that belong to a bandwidth constrained task_group we introduce > tg_request_cfs_quota() which attempts to allocate quota from the global pool > for use locally. Updates involving the global pool are currently protected > under cfs_bandwidth->lock, local pools are protected by rq->lock. > > This patch only attempts to assign and track quota, no action is taken in the > case that cfs_rq->quota_used exceeds cfs_rq->quota_assigned. > > Signed-off-by: Paul Turner <pjt@google.com> > Signed-off-by: Nikhil Rao <ncrao@google.com> > Signed-off-by: Bharata B Rao <bharata@linux.vnet.ibm.com> > --- > include/linux/sched.h | 4 ++++ > kernel/sched.c | 13 +++++++++++++ > kernel/sched_fair.c | 50 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 > kernel/sysctl.c | 10 ++++++++++ > 4 files changed, 77 insertions(+) > > --- a/include/linux/sched.h > +++ b/include/linux/sched.h > @@ -1898,6 +1898,10 @@ int sched_rt_handler(struct ctl_table *t > void __user *buffer, size_t *lenp, > loff_t *ppos); > > +#ifdef CONFIG_CFS_BANDWIDTH > +extern unsigned int sysctl_sched_cfs_bandwidth_slice; > +#endif > + > extern unsigned int sysctl_sched_compat_yield; > > #ifdef CONFIG_RT_MUTEXES > --- a/kernel/sched.c > +++ b/kernel/sched.c > @@ -1929,6 +1929,19 @@ static const struct sched_class rt_sched > * default: 0.5s > */ > static u64 sched_cfs_bandwidth_period = 500000000ULL; > + > +/* > + * default slice of quota to allocate from global tg to local cfs_rq pool on > + * each refresh > + * default: 10ms > + */ > +unsigned int sysctl_sched_cfs_bandwidth_slice = 10000UL; > + > +static inline u64 sched_cfs_bandwidth_slice(void) > +{ > + return (u64)sysctl_sched_cfs_bandwidth_slice * NSEC_PER_USEC; > +} > + > #endif > > #define sched_class_highest (&rt_sched_class) > --- a/kernel/sched_fair.c > +++ b/kernel/sched_fair.c > @@ -267,6 +267,16 @@ find_matching_se(struct sched_entity **s > > #endif /* CONFIG_FAIR_GROUP_SCHED */ > > +#ifdef CONFIG_CFS_BANDWIDTH > +static inline struct cfs_bandwidth *tg_cfs_bandwidth(struct task_group *tg) > +{ > + return &tg->cfs_bandwidth; > +} > + > +static void account_cfs_rq_quota(struct cfs_rq *cfs_rq, > + unsigned long delta_exec); > +#endif > + > > /************************************************************** > * Scheduling class tree data structure manipulation methods: > @@ -547,6 +557,9 @@ static void update_curr(struct cfs_rq *c > cpuacct_charge(curtask, delta_exec); > account_group_exec_runtime(curtask, delta_exec); > } > +#ifdef CONFIG_CFS_BANDWIDTH > + account_cfs_rq_quota(cfs_rq, delta_exec); > +#endif > } > > static inline void > @@ -1130,6 +1143,43 @@ static void yield_task_fair(struct rq *r > } > > #ifdef CONFIG_CFS_BANDWIDTH > +static u64 tg_request_cfs_quota(struct task_group *tg) > +{ > + struct cfs_bandwidth *cfs_b = tg_cfs_bandwidth(tg); > + u64 delta = 0; > + > + if (cfs_b->runtime > 0 || cfs_b->quota == RUNTIME_INF) {
